What is Extended Reality?
Extended reality refers to a spread of technologies that enhance or transform the actual world by overlaying digital information, images, or objects. AR, VR, and MR are the three primary components of XR, each with its unique characteristics and applications.
Augmented Reality (AR)
AR involves overlaying digital information, images, or objects onto the actual world, using devices corresponding to smartphones, tablets, or smart glasses. In construction, AR might be used to visualise constructing designs, discover potential issues, and enhance collaboration amongst stakeholders.
Applications of AR in Construction
AR has quite a few applications in construction, including:
- Site planning and management
- Building design and visualization
- Quality control and inspection
- Training and education
Virtual Reality (VR)
VR involves immersing users in a very virtual environment, using devices corresponding to head-mounted displays (HMDs) or VR headsets. In construction, VR might be used to create immersive experiences for training, education, and client engagement.
Mixed Reality (MR)
MR combines elements of AR and VR to create a hybrid experience that blends the physical and digital worlds. In construction, MR might be used to reinforce collaboration, improve communication, and reduce errors.
